# Pylon Chat — Environments

Quick note for release: the websocket reconnect bug only reproduces in staging because prod and staging use different keepalive settings. Don't promote build 412 until QA re-tests against prod-like values. To save you digging through Fennick's deploy repo, here are the production settings staging needs to match.

config for kafof-bawef:
holath:
  log_level: debug
  metrics_host: metrics.holath.qorvelsys.internal
  pin: 2191
  pool_size: 32

# Break-Glass: Catalog Cache Invalidation

Scope: the Pinrow product catalog at Veldstone Retail. If stale prices persist after a purge and the Hollowmere invalidation queue is wedged, use break-glass to flush the edge tier directly. Contractors: get verbal sign-off from the catalog lead first. Steps: open the Hollowmere admin shell, select emergency-flush, confirm the tenant, and run it once — repeated flushes thrash the origin. Access is logged and expires after 20 minutes. Unseal the admin shell with the passphrase below.

recovery phrase for kahop-tajog: istix-casvan

Undo/redo recovery — Sketchmere editor. Symptom: undo stack desyncs after collaborative merge, redo replays stale ops. Check: compare local op counter against the Tarrow sync log; a gap over 3 means the merge resolver dropped frames. Fix: flush the client stack via the debug panel, force a full document reload, confirm counters match. Do not hot-patch the resolver in prod — last attempt corrupted two boards in the Nellcroft workspace. Escalate persistent desyncs with the trace token emitted on reload.

trace token, fafog-kageg: htk4_98e6

# Approvals — TilePloy Map-Tile Prefetcher

TilePloy prefetches map tiles for the Wayfarer app based on predicted routes. Any change to prefetch radius, cache eviction, or upstream tile quotas requires written approval, since misconfiguration can exhaust bandwidth budgets overnight. Submit changes through the standard review queue and obtain sign-off from the responsible maintainer named below.

signatory, tageg-hahof: Ralion Kelion Fraael